Eddie Posted March 26, 2009 Share Posted March 26, 2009 If, like me, you normally only use sites with an E. H. U. , then I would be content with an 85 amp. - even if you have a mover. I was supplied with one at 110 amp, but as far as I'm concerned the 110 is only extra weight, because there is quite a difference in weight between the two. RogerL Posted March 26, 2009 Share Posted March 26, 2009 The dial is a voltmeter - whenever the on-board power suppy is active, the battery and voltmeter should show 13. 8v but will drop back to 12. 0-12. 8v when not being charged. A colour-coded voltmeter could ideally do with being calibrated in volts as well - if you have a digital volt meter (DVM) you may be able to get an idea of colour/voltage.
